WebJun 17, 2024 · Risk factors to know. Age Advancing age does not cause Alzheimer's, but it is the greatest known risk factor. About 1 in 9 people 65 and older have Alzheimer's dementia. After age 65, the risk doubles every five years, and about a third of people older than 85 have the disease. WebJul 29, 2024 · Vascular dementia signs and symptoms include: Confusion.
